left menu 두번째 난관...ㅜ.ㅜ > 그누4 질문답변

그누4 질문답변

그누보드4 관련 질문은 QA 로 이전됩니다. QA 그누보드4 바로가기
기존 게시물은 열람만 가능합니다.

left menu 두번째 난관...ㅜ.ㅜ 정보

left menu 두번째 난관...ㅜ.ㅜ

본문

안녕하세요~!! 얼마전 root님의 도움으로 왼쪽자동 메뉴에 일반 페이지를 넣기 성공한 사람입니다. root님의 자세한 설명에 차근차근 따라해 보니 어느세 일반 페이지가 왼쪽 메뉴로 쏘옥 들어 가더라구요, 근데 다른 난관을 만났습니다. 
 
계시판에서 뽑아온 메뉴를 큭릭하고 계시판으로 이동시 메뉴의 글자도 색깔이 이쁘게 변합니다. 현제 위치를 알려주기 좋은거 같은데 일반페이지를 클릭할경우 변화 없이 그대로 있습니다. 
 
혹 아시는 분은 도움 부탁 드립니다.
 
여기 소스첨부 드립니다.
 
<? if($gr_id){ ?>
<!-- Nav_V -->
<table width="100" cellpadding=0 cellspacing=0><tr><td height=4 align="center" valign=top></td></tr></table>
<table style="border-collapse:collapse;" align="center" cellpadding="0" cellspacing="0" width="180">
  <!--DWLayoutTable-->
    <tr>
        <td width="180" height="5" colspan="3">
            <p><img src="<?=$g4['path']?>/include/leftmenu/img/outline_top.gif" width="180" height="5" border="0"></p>
        </td>
    </tr>
    <tr>
        <td width="5" background="<?=$g4['path']?>/include/leftmenu/img/outline_left.gif">
        </td>
        <td width="170" align="center">
     
<!-- Nav_V -->
<table width='170' border='0' cellspacing='0' cellpadding='0'>
<tr>
<td align="center">
 
<table width='100%' align="center" cellpadding=0 cellspacing=0 border=0>
<?
$red_bullet="<img src='$g4[path]/gnusr/images/bullets/circle03_orange.gif' width='6' height='10' align='middle'>";
$blue_bullet="<img src='$g4[path]/include/leftmenu/img/icl.gif' border='0'>";
$blue_bullet1="<img src='$g4[path]/include/leftmenu/img/icl1.gif' border='0'>";
$line_shadow = "<td height=1 background='$g4[path]/include/leftmenu/img/dot_line.gif'></td></tr>";
 
$sql = " select gr_id, gr_subject from $g4[group_table] where gr_id = '$gr_id'";//해당그룹 $gr_id를 해당그룹명으로 대체가능
// morning님 전체그룹에서 제외그룹설정
/*
$sql = " select * from $g4[group_table] where gr_id not in ('test', 'test2') order by gr_id ";
$sql = " select * from $g4[group_table]
where gr_id <> 'photo'
and gr_id <> 'common'
and gr_id <> '제외그룹3'
order by gr_id ";
*/
$result = sql_query($sql);
while ($row=mysql_fetch_array($result)) {
//그룹을 보여준다면
echo "<tr><td background='$g4[path]/include/leftmenu/img/lbg.gif' height='37' align='center'>";
echo "<br>$row[gr_subject]</td></tr>";
 
if($row[gr_id] == "intro") {
echo "<tr><td width=\"100%\" height='25' align='left' class='left_menu_btn'>   $blue_bullet  <a href='$g4[path]//mpc_greeting.php' class='list_menu' onfocus='this.blur()'>인사말</a> </td></tr>";  //네모 뷸릿 + 테이블명
echo "<tr><td width=\"100%\" height='25' align='left' class='left_menu_btn'>   $blue_bullet  <a href='$g4[path]/mpc_vision.php' class='list_menu' onfocus='this.blur()'>우리의비전</a> </td></tr>";  //네모 뷸릿 + 테이블명echo "<tr><td width=\"100%\" height='25' align='left' class='left_menu_btn'>   $blue_bullet  <a href='$g4[path]/mpc_serve.php' class='list_menu' onfocus='this.blur()'>섬기는분</a> </td></tr>";  //네모 뷸릿 + 테이블명
echo "<tr><td width=\"100%\" height='25' align='left' class='left_menu_btn'>   $blue_bullet  <a href='$g4[path]/mpc_map.php' class='list_menu' onfocus='this.blur()'>오시는길</a> </td></tr>";  //네모 뷸릿 + 테이블명
}
 
// 게시판 목록보기 권한설정순 정렬
//$sql2 = " SELECT bo_subject, bo_table from $g4[board_table] where (bo_list_level <= $member[mb_level]) and (gr_id = '$row[gr_id]') order by bo_subject ";//참고하세요.
$sql2 = " select bo_subject, bo_table from $g4[board_table] where (bo_list_level <= $member[mb_level]) and (gr_id = '$row[gr_id]') and bo_use_search = '1' order by bo_order_search";
//제외보드설정
//$sql2 = " select * from $g4[board_table]
//where gr_id = '$row[gr_id]'
//and bo_table  <> '제외보드1'
//and bo_table  <> '제외보드2'
//order by bo_order_search ";
$result2 = sql_query($sql2);
$bar = "";
while ($row2=mysql_fetch_array($result2)) {
$new_time = date("Y-m-d H:i:s", time()-3600*$row2[bo_new]);
$sql3 = " select count(*) as cnt from $g4[write_prefix]$row2[bo_table] where wr_datetime >= '$new_time' ";
$row3 = sql_fetch($sql3);
if ($row3[cnt] > 0)
$new = " <img src='$g4[path]/include/leftmenu/img/icon_new.gif' border='0'>"; //new 아이콘
else
$new = ""; //new 아이콘 없음
echo "<tr><td width=\"100%\" height='25' align='left' class='left_menu_btn'>";
//g6man님 해당게시판 볼드체로
if ($row2[bo_table] == $bo_table)
echo "   $blue_bullet1  <a href='$g4[bbs_path]/board.php?bo_table=$row2[bo_table]' class='list_menu menu_on' onfocus='this.blur()'><font color=#6b98cf><b>$row2[bo_subject]<b></font></a> $new";
//echo "<a href='$g4[bbs_path]/board.php?bo_table=$row2[bo_table]' class='list_menu menu_on' onfocus='this.blur()'>$row2[bo_subject]</a>  $blue_bullet1  ";
else
echo "   $blue_bullet  <a href='$g4[bbs_path]/board.php?bo_table=$row2[bo_table]' class='list_menu' onfocus='this.blur()'>$row2[bo_subject]</a> "; //네모 뷸릿 + 테이블명 + new 아이콘
}
}//}
echo "</td></tr>";
?>
</table>
 
</td>
</tr>
</table>
<!--네비게이션 메뉴 끝-->
 
 
 
        </td>
        <td width="5" background="<?=$g4['path']?>/include/leftmenu/img/outline_right.gif">
        </td>
    </tr>
    <tr>
        <td width="180" height="5" colspan="3">
            <p><img src="<?=$g4['path']?>/include/leftmenu/img/outline_bottom.gif" width="180" height="5" border="0"></p>
        </td>
    </tr>
    <tr>
      <td height="21"></td>
      <td></td>
      <td></td>
    </tr>
</table>
<? } ?>

댓글 전체

님, 우선 빠른 답변 감사 드립니다.
각각의 페이지에 $gr_id = "intro"; // 이 파일의 그룹은? 라고 정의되어 있습니다.
이렇게 안해주면 일반 페이지에서 왼쪽 메뉴가 안 보이더라구요~~!!^^;
항상 질답란에 남겨주신 님의 답변이 많은 도움이 되고 있습니다. 이자릴 빌어 감사 드립니다.
꾸벅
전체 66,554 |RSS
그누4 질문답변 내용 검색

회원로그인

(주)에스아이알소프트 / 대표:홍석명 / (06211) 서울특별시 강남구 역삼동 707-34 한신인터밸리24 서관 1402호 / E-Mail: admin@sir.kr
사업자등록번호: 217-81-36347 / 통신판매업신고번호:2014-서울강남-02098호 / 개인정보보호책임자:김민섭(minsup@sir.kr)
© SIRSOFT